在企业数字化转型进程中,通用型管理软件往往难以应对个性化业务场景 —— 制造业的工单流转、零售业的会员体系、跨境企业的多币种核算,这些独特的业务逻辑需要定制化系统来承载。定制化企业管理软件开发的核心命题,在于让代码逻辑精准映射业务流程,实现技术与业务的 “无缝咬合”。
精准匹配的前提是对业务逻辑的深度解构。开发团队需建立 “三维调研体系”:通过高管访谈明确战略级业务目标,例如某汽车零部件企业希望通过系统实现 “订单 - 生产 - 物流” 全链路可视化;与中层管理者梳理跨部门协作流程,绘制包含 12 个节点的采购审批流程图,标注每个节点的权责划分与时限要求;深入一线操作场景,记录仓库管理员扫码入库的 37 个动作细节,捕捉 “人工暂存区” 这类未被标准化的隐性流程。某 ERP 实施案例显示,经过 6 周全维度调研形成的业务逻辑手册,能使后期需求变更率降低 40%。
将业务逻辑转化为技术语言需要搭建 “翻译桥梁”。在需求分析阶段,采用 “业务用例图 + 数据流图” 双重表达:用泳道图直观呈现销售部门与财务部门的单据传递关系,用 ER 图定义 “客户 - 订单 - 产品” 的实体关联规则。开发团队需掌握 “业务抽象” 能力,例如将制造业的 “工单变更” 场景抽象为 “主数据版本控制 + 关联单据同步更新” 的技术模型,既保留业务灵活性,又确保系统稳定性。某食品加工企业的定制系统中,开发团队针对 “批次追溯” 需求,设计出包含原料来源、生产班组、质检报告的三维数据结构,完美复现了企业的质量追溯逻辑。
流程引擎的柔性设计是应对业务变化的关键。定制化系统需避免将业务逻辑 “硬编码”,而是通过可视化流程配置平台,让企业能自主调整审批节点、表单字段等要素。例如某连锁餐饮企业的排班系统,开发时预留了 “门店类型(直营店 / 加盟店)”“用工模式(全职 / 兼职)” 等变量维度,当企业新增加盟业务时,无需修改代码即可通过配置实现排班规则的适配。这种 “规则引擎 + 业务参数” 的架构设计,能使系统对业务变化的响应速度提升 60%。
测试环节需构建 “业务场景沙盘”。除常规功能测试外,重点开展 “模拟实战” 验证:按旺季峰值数据量进行订单录入测试,验证系统对 “爆单” 场景的处理逻辑;模拟员工误操作场景,测试系统的容错机制是否符合业务习惯;组织最终用户进行为期 3 天的全真模拟运行,记录下 “扫码枪识别延迟时的人工补录流程” 等 23 处优化点。某物流企业的 TMS 系统通过 127 个真实业务场景测试,将上线后的操作失误率控制在 0.3% 以下。
持续迭代是保持匹配度的长效机制。系统上线后需建立 “业务逻辑反馈通道”,通过埋点分析识别异常操作 —— 当采购人员频繁绕过系统录入供应商信息时,可能意味着 “供应商准入流程过于繁琐”;通过季度业务评审会,将新品类拓展、政策调整等新业务需求转化为系统优化项。某跨境电商平台每年进行 2 次大版本迭代、12 次小功能更新,使系统始终与企业的出海业务逻辑同步进化。
技术与业务的深度融合,最终体现在用户体验的 “自然感” 中 —— 当仓库管理员觉得系统操作比手工台账更顺手,当财务人员能通过自定义报表快速生成管理层需要的数据,这种 “用起来像为自己量身定做” 的体验,正是定制化系统精准匹配业务逻辑的最佳证明。在这场 “业务驱动技术,技术反哺业务” 的循环中,定制化开发不仅是工具的打造,更是企业管理逻辑的数字化重塑。